Overview

AIApply is a web-based job application platform that combines AI-powered resume building, cover letter generation, and automated application submission into a single workflow. The platform's core value proposition is efficiency at scale: it automatically tailors every resume and cover letter to match specific job descriptions, aiming to help candidates navigate Applicant Tracking Systems and reach hiring managers faster than manual customization allows.

The feature set spans the full application lifecycle. Users begin with the AI Resume Builder, which accepts either new creation or imported existing resumes. The AI Cover Letter Generator produces personalized letters keyed to role descriptions. An Auto-Apply feature submits applications in volume — one user testimonial on the vendor's site reports 150 applications yielding two confirmed interviews in a single week, though this figure lacks independent corroboration. For interview preparation, an Interview Buddy provides practice sessions, but source material documents setup difficulties specifically with Microsoft Teams interviews, which the vendor's support team subsequently addressed.

On the customization side, AIApply positions itself as a collaborator rather than a black box. Users can edit every AI-generated section, regenerate individual components, reorder content, and add emphasis. A library of ATS-friendly templates supports instant preview and one-click style switching. The platform supports export in multiple formats, though the specific output options are not enumerated in available documentation.

Two notable gaps emerge from the source material. First, pricing is entirely absent from the homepage — prospective users cannot evaluate cost against claimed value. Second, the platform's most consequential claims around ATS optimization and auto-apply effectiveness rest on vendor descriptions and a single uncorroborated testimonial. Independent benchmarking or third-party validation of these capabilities is not present in the evidence packet.

Within the broader Job Search ecosystem, AIApply competes with tools like ProfileClaw and CV Lab, each targeting different segments of the job search automation market. AIApply's differentiator is the breadth of its pipeline — from resume creation through application submission — though users should weigh this breadth against the gaps in independent evidence and pricing transparency.

AIApply is best suited for job seekers running high-volume application campaigns who value automation over personalization depth. Career changers and entry-level candidates may find particular utility in the ATS keyword optimization. However, users with interviews scheduled on Microsoft Teams should approach Interview Buddy with caution given the documented setup issues. Those requiring pricing certainty or independent performance data will need to seek additional information beyond what the current source material provides.
